Yup, for that one part, you'll wanna crossover. For a while I kept doing LL for the RY and the YRY part, but that wasn't working. Then I just crossed over one time (aka start on right, so its RLRL for RYOY). Everything technical is way easier to do on a set with cymbals, especially the WT ones.

Now, the X+ aspect of this song... practice fast stuff. I still haven't figured out that triple bass thing they throw at you every other time in the chorus or whatever, but I do have the standard 16th notes, which are about as easy as they sound after a while.

For a RB kit you can either cross your hands when you hit the BYBY part with your left hand on top or you can cross your right hand over to hit the R and then bring it back over to hit the rest of the Bs while your left hand hits the Ys the whole time (as shown in Sublime's vid)

Its actually very simple....when the snare comes up, hit it with your right and move it back towards the cymbal, then you just do LRLRLRLRLR....so its just R(snare)LRLRLRLRLRLRL.....its a bit awkward to start, but once you combo it you'll feel it. U Need WT drums...RB drums just don't cut it...
